Support has reported inconsistent button and modal styling across tenant apps. Root cause: three downstream services pinned different minor versions of Lattice UI after the registry mirror lagged behind the canonical feed. Versioning policy says all consumers must track the same minor release line, but drift detection was disabled during the Brindlewood migration and never re-enabled. Until the sync job is restored, support should verify reports against the expected baseline. The intended canonical configuration is as follows.

deployment values, yadup-kadug:
[sorys]
port = 5672
team = noveth
host = sorys.orvexcorp.example
region = south-4
access_code = ac_deddc1
timeout_ms = 1500

## Releases

Hey support folks — quick notes on ProfileMesh shard releases. Each release re-balances user-profile shards gradually, so don't panic if a lookup lands on a stale shard for a few minutes post-deploy; it self-heals. Release bundles are published twice a month and are always signed. If a customer asks you to verify a bundle they downloaded, walk them through the checksum step using the public signing key below.

deploy key for kawif-bageg: bky19_YQNdHDgpaLxUNwPoHm9

**Dark mode in the Fennwick admin dashboard**

If your plugin panel looks washed out in dark mode, you're probably hard-coding hex values instead of using our theme tokens. Don't do that — pull colors from the `fw-theme` variables and everything flips automatically. Charts are the usual offender; the legacy chart kit ignores tokens entirely, so swap to the v3 kit. Test both modes before submitting, since review will bounce anything unreadable. Token reference and migration notes are on the page below.

wiki page, tahaf-tajog: https://jira.ordindyn.corp/pipeline

**09:17** — Confirmed that Brindlecache nodes continued serving expired session entries after the invalidation fanout failed. No evidence of tampering; the failure was a dropped broker connection. We isolated the affected tier and redeployed with forced cache flush. The build deployed during remediation is identified immediately below.

pipeline stamp: htk31_f769b577b3028a4e9958e5bb8d1259a